One of the worst jobs I had was working in a plastics factory. I was alone in a room with a huge injection mold machine, making big plastic pails. A huge plunger would pull back and a pail would drop out. My job was to put the pails in a big box. It took about 3 minutes for the machine to cycle, so I had to wait for the machine to drop out a pail. When you're waiting, 3 minutes is a year. I was SO BORED, and after 8 hours, AAAAAGGGHHHHHH!!!!
I lasted only 1 day.
